
Roots of Resilience Lifelong Learning Series – Painting Gardens in Winter
February 12 / 11:00 AM - 2:00 PM“Painting Gardens in Winter”
Free Acrylic Painting Workshop for all levels, Beginners welcome!
Our Roots of Resilience Lifelong Learning Series celebrates the ways colour, memory, and lived experience shape our shared natural history. This Free Painting Workshop invites participants to create a guided garden landscape, an artwork inspired by the gardens they’ve tended, visited, or carried with them across time.
The session blends gentle instruction with personal reflection, encouraging participants to explore how gardens act as living archives of resilience, growth, and connection.
Participants will be guided step‑by‑step through creating a vibrant garden scene with acrylic paint. The painting will be simple enough for beginners yet open to personal interpretation.
